Handover note — for the records team

Petra, the three raffle drums for the Midwinter staff party are packed in the grey crates in storage room B, each with its ticket rolls sealed inside. Crate lids are numbered and logged in the assets ledger. Borvane Events will collect them Thursday morning. Please apply the following instruction at the courier hand-over.

courier memo of yawep-yafog: the pramir ulaix courier leaves the ulavan aldix frair zorok oliiel joreth rusdor fenvan ledger at gate 1305 under passcode 514738

**Alert: tailfox CLI — tail session failures**

The tailfox CLI is failing to open tail sessions against the Greymarsh log brokers. Error rate above 30% for 15 minutes. Release impact: deploy verification relies on live tails, so holds may be needed. Workaround: use the batch-pull mode until sessions recover. Triage steps and current broker status are tracked on the page below.

dashboard of bajef-bageg = https://confluence.lumiclabs.internal/browse/browse/pages/display/93ae

### Step 4: Enable offline mode

Alright, this is the fiddly bit. TrailNote's offline mode caches survey forms locally and queues submissions until the handset finds signal again. Before flipping it on, make sure the sync worker from Step 3 is healthy, or you'll get a queue that grows forever. Once you've verified that, restart the agent and it'll pick up the new cache settings. Drop in the following values when prompted:

service settings:
PRAIX_LOG_LEVEL=error
PRAIX_METRICS_HOST=metrics.praix.qorvelcorp.corp
PRAIX_POOL_SIZE=16

## Sensor drift: what to do at 3am

If the GrowLoop controller starts reporting humidity swings that don't match the backup probes in the Fernwick greenhouse, it's almost always sensor drift, not an actual climate event. Don't panic and don't touch the vents manually. First, restart the calibration daemon and give it ten minutes to re-baseline. If readings still disagree by more than 5%, flip the controller into safe mode. The safe-mode thresholds it will use are these.

config for yahap-bajof:
[istix]
host = istix.qorvelsys.internal
user = istix_svc
database = istix_prod